I recently moved to Canada (October 08) and have been working for a couple of months now. I am a PR card holder and my immigration is complete.

I am reading up on tax issues in a book and because I came over with a moderately sized amount of money, I have a desire to invest whatever I legally can into an RRSP.

The literature I have states that I am bound to investing only 18% of my previous years earnings.

Am I to assume that since I do not presently have any filings with the CRA that I am not allowed to contribute into an RRSP?
